Materials

The couch's fabric is what makes it feel, look and function however there are so many options available that it is difficult to know where to start. The best choice depends on a range of factors, including how often the sofa will be used and whether there are pets or children living in the home.

If the sofa is going to be located in an area with a lot of traffic it must be able to withstand wear and wear and tear. An ideal choice is a synthetic fabric like olefin. It blends petroleum and polypropylene to create a tough fabric that is also water-resistant. This is a great choice for a sofa that is family-friendly, as it will stand well against spills and other household stains.

Natural fabrics such as cotton, linen and wool are classic and is perfect for any decor, [Redirect Only] but can be more susceptible to staining. Because of this, they are a better choice for lower-traffic areas. Silk is a different luxurious option that is extremely soft and elegant but tends to snag more easily than other fabrics, so it should only be utilized in rooms that are frequented. If durability and easy maintenance are your top priorities, you should consider a wool-blend fabric, which provides the advantages of both synthetic and natural materials.

Ottomans

Ottomans are a wonderful addition to a living room. They are upholstered footstools which can be used to seat or tables. They come in many different sizes and shapes. They can also be customized to meet your needs. They can be upholstered in different fabrics ranging from traditional tufted fabrics to cheerfully informal.

Ottomans were first invented in modern-day Turkey and were introduced to Europe for the first time in the 18th Century. They are typically cushioned and have the ability to be used as seating or footstools. They can be shaped into an oblong box with legs that are long or they may look like a pouf with short legs. They can be upholstered with different styles of fabric including velvet, microfibre and chenille. They can be decorated by buttons or tufting and have a decorative or flat top.

The type of fabric you select for your ottoman is important because it will be subject to lots of wear and wear and tear. The fabric should be easy to clean. Regularly vacuuming your ottoman and spot-cleaning it when staining is evident is highly recommended. Avoid placing heavy objects or items on your ottoman as they could leave marks.
